How can I build a inexpensive gas kiln to fire clay outside?


Best Answer - Chosen by Asker: The easiest way is to find an old electric kiln and strip out the elements. Cut a hole in the lid and insert a stove pipe chimney. Build a square firebox out of fire brick. Leave a port hole for the gas burner on one side and place a baffle brick inside to deflect the flame into a circular path. It will spiral up through the contents. Use a digital thermocouple to take temp or set up several pyrometric cones close to the peep holes do you can check themp
